Skip to content

Commit f334875

Browse files
committed
NFR Test Results for NGF version edge
1 parent e03b181 commit f334875

File tree

2 files changed

+100
-303
lines changed

2 files changed

+100
-303
lines changed

tests/results/reconfig/edge/edge-oss.md

Lines changed: 50 additions & 151 deletions
Original file line numberDiff line numberDiff line change
@@ -6,201 +6,100 @@ NGINX Plus: false
66

77
NGINX Gateway Fabric:
88

9-
- Commit: 9155a2b6a8d3179165797ef3e789e97283f7a695
10-
- Date: 2025-03-15T07:17:11Z
9+
- Commit: e03b181692b24863f029d591a9cac59e1d44a8b7
10+
- Date: 2025-09-09T14:26:43Z
1111
- Dirty: false
1212

1313
GKE Cluster:
1414

1515
- Node count: 12
16-
- k8s version: v1.31.6-gke.1020000
16+
- k8s version: v1.33.3-gke.1136000
1717
- vCPUs per node: 16
18-
- RAM per node: 65851340Ki
18+
- RAM per node: 65851524Ki
1919
- Max pods per node: 110
2020
- Zone: us-west1-b
2121
- Instance Type: n2d-standard-16
2222

2323
## Test 1: Resources exist before startup - NumResources 30
2424

25-
### Reloads and Time to Ready
25+
### Time to Ready
2626

27-
- TimeToReadyTotal: 3s
28-
- TimeToReadyAvgSingle: < 1s
29-
- NGINX Reloads: 2
30-
- NGINX Reload Average Time: 101ms
31-
- Reload distribution:
32-
- 500.0ms: 2
33-
- 1000.0ms: 2
34-
- 5000.0ms: 2
35-
- 10000.0ms: 2
36-
- 30000.0ms: 2
37-
- +Infms: 2
27+
Time To Ready Description: From when NGF starts to when the NGINX configuration is fully configured
28+
- TimeToReadyTotal: 23s
3829

3930
### Event Batch Processing
4031

41-
- Event Batch Total: 5
42-
- Event Batch Processing Average Time: 53ms
32+
- Event Batch Total: 10
33+
- Event Batch Processing Average Time: 2ms
4334
- Event Batch Processing distribution:
44-
- 500.0ms: 5
45-
- 1000.0ms: 5
46-
- 5000.0ms: 5
47-
- 10000.0ms: 5
48-
- 30000.0ms: 5
49-
- +Infms: 5
35+
- 500.0ms: 10
36+
- 1000.0ms: 10
37+
- 5000.0ms: 10
38+
- 10000.0ms: 10
39+
- 30000.0ms: 10
40+
- +Infms: 10
5041

5142
### NGINX Error Logs
5243

53-
5444
## Test 1: Resources exist before startup - NumResources 150
5545

56-
### Reloads and Time to Ready
46+
### Time to Ready
5747

58-
- TimeToReadyTotal: 3s
59-
- TimeToReadyAvgSingle: < 1s
60-
- NGINX Reloads: 2
61-
- NGINX Reload Average Time: 88ms
62-
- Reload distribution:
63-
- 500.0ms: 2
64-
- 1000.0ms: 2
65-
- 5000.0ms: 2
66-
- 10000.0ms: 2
67-
- 30000.0ms: 2
68-
- +Infms: 2
48+
Time To Ready Description: From when NGF starts to when the NGINX configuration is fully configured
49+
- TimeToReadyTotal: 21s
6950

7051
### Event Batch Processing
7152

72-
- Event Batch Total: 6
73-
- Event Batch Processing Average Time: 45ms
53+
- Event Batch Total: 8
54+
- Event Batch Processing Average Time: 8ms
7455
- Event Batch Processing distribution:
75-
- 500.0ms: 6
76-
- 1000.0ms: 6
77-
- 5000.0ms: 6
78-
- 10000.0ms: 6
79-
- 30000.0ms: 6
80-
- +Infms: 6
56+
- 500.0ms: 8
57+
- 1000.0ms: 8
58+
- 5000.0ms: 8
59+
- 10000.0ms: 8
60+
- 30000.0ms: 8
61+
- +Infms: 8
8162

8263
### NGINX Error Logs
8364

65+
## Test 2: Start NGF, deploy Gateway, wait until NGINX agent instance connects to NGF, create many resources attached to GW - NumResources 30
8466

85-
## Test 2: Start NGF, deploy Gateway, create many resources attached to GW - NumResources 30
86-
87-
### Reloads and Time to Ready
67+
### Time to Ready
8868

89-
- TimeToReadyTotal: 8s
90-
- TimeToReadyAvgSingle: < 1s
91-
- NGINX Reloads: 63
92-
- NGINX Reload Average Time: 125ms
93-
- Reload distribution:
94-
- 500.0ms: 63
95-
- 1000.0ms: 63
96-
- 5000.0ms: 63
97-
- 10000.0ms: 63
98-
- 30000.0ms: 63
99-
- +Infms: 63
69+
Time To Ready Description: From when NGINX receives the first configuration created by NGF to when the NGINX configuration is fully configured
70+
- TimeToReadyTotal: 26s
10071

10172
### Event Batch Processing
10273

103-
- Event Batch Total: 337
104-
- Event Batch Processing Average Time: 23ms
74+
- Event Batch Total: 263
75+
- Event Batch Processing Average Time: 31ms
10576
- Event Batch Processing distribution:
106-
- 500.0ms: 337
107-
- 1000.0ms: 337
108-
- 5000.0ms: 337
109-
- 10000.0ms: 337
110-
- 30000.0ms: 337
111-
- +Infms: 337
77+
- 500.0ms: 256
78+
- 1000.0ms: 263
79+
- 5000.0ms: 263
80+
- 10000.0ms: 263
81+
- 30000.0ms: 263
82+
- +Infms: 263
11283

11384
### NGINX Error Logs
11485

86+
## Test 2: Start NGF, deploy Gateway, wait until NGINX agent instance connects to NGF, create many resources attached to GW - NumResources 150
11587

116-
## Test 2: Start NGF, deploy Gateway, create many resources attached to GW - NumResources 150
117-
118-
### Reloads and Time to Ready
88+
### Time to Ready
11989

120-
- TimeToReadyTotal: 44s
121-
- TimeToReadyAvgSingle: < 1s
122-
- NGINX Reloads: 343
123-
- NGINX Reload Average Time: 125ms
124-
- Reload distribution:
125-
- 500.0ms: 343
126-
- 1000.0ms: 343
127-
- 5000.0ms: 343
128-
- 10000.0ms: 343
129-
- 30000.0ms: 343
130-
- +Infms: 343
90+
Time To Ready Description: From when NGINX receives the first configuration created by NGF to when the NGINX configuration is fully configured
91+
- TimeToReadyTotal: 102s
13192

13293
### Event Batch Processing
13394

134-
- Event Batch Total: 1689
135-
- Event Batch Processing Average Time: 25ms
136-
- Event Batch Processing distribution:
137-
- 500.0ms: 1689
138-
- 1000.0ms: 1689
139-
- 5000.0ms: 1689
140-
- 10000.0ms: 1689
141-
- 30000.0ms: 1689
142-
- +Infms: 1689
143-
144-
### NGINX Error Logs
145-
146-
147-
## Test 3: Start NGF, create many resources attached to a Gateway, deploy the Gateway - NumResources 30
148-
149-
### Reloads and Time to Ready
150-
151-
- TimeToReadyTotal: < 1s
152-
- TimeToReadyAvgSingle: < 1s
153-
- NGINX Reloads: 64
154-
- NGINX Reload Average Time: 125ms
155-
- Reload distribution:
156-
- 500.0ms: 64
157-
- 1000.0ms: 64
158-
- 5000.0ms: 64
159-
- 10000.0ms: 64
160-
- 30000.0ms: 64
161-
- +Infms: 64
162-
163-
### Event Batch Processing
164-
165-
- Event Batch Total: 321
166-
- Event Batch Processing Average Time: 25ms
167-
- Event Batch Processing distribution:
168-
- 500.0ms: 321
169-
- 1000.0ms: 321
170-
- 5000.0ms: 321
171-
- 10000.0ms: 321
172-
- 30000.0ms: 321
173-
- +Infms: 321
174-
175-
### NGINX Error Logs
176-
177-
178-
## Test 3: Start NGF, create many resources attached to a Gateway, deploy the Gateway - NumResources 150
179-
180-
### Reloads and Time to Ready
181-
182-
- TimeToReadyTotal: < 1s
183-
- TimeToReadyAvgSingle: < 1s
184-
- NGINX Reloads: 342
185-
- NGINX Reload Average Time: 125ms
186-
- Reload distribution:
187-
- 500.0ms: 342
188-
- 1000.0ms: 342
189-
- 5000.0ms: 342
190-
- 10000.0ms: 342
191-
- 30000.0ms: 342
192-
- +Infms: 342
193-
194-
### Event Batch Processing
195-
196-
- Event Batch Total: 1639
197-
- Event Batch Processing Average Time: 26ms
95+
- Event Batch Total: 1240
96+
- Event Batch Processing Average Time: 23ms
19897
- Event Batch Processing distribution:
199-
- 500.0ms: 1639
200-
- 1000.0ms: 1639
201-
- 5000.0ms: 1639
202-
- 10000.0ms: 1639
203-
- 30000.0ms: 1639
204-
- +Infms: 1639
98+
- 500.0ms: 1209
99+
- 1000.0ms: 1240
100+
- 5000.0ms: 1240
101+
- 10000.0ms: 1240
102+
- 30000.0ms: 1240
103+
- +Infms: 1240
205104

206105
### NGINX Error Logs

0 commit comments

Comments
 (0)